Expat Forum For People Moving Overseas And Living Abroad banner
ticket to uk
1-1 of 1 Results
  1. Britain Expat Forum for Expats Living in the UK
    Hello All, I searched all threads but couldn't find an answer to my query in british forum so posting a thread related to it. (Hope this time I have posted accurately as twice I have been guided by Joppa to post under write threads-:D) Was curious to know that should I book my flight to UK...
1-1 of 1 Results